Transaction 100995230fd30b692b4ca5fca2053b0ac7fdb168c97bb8d96ac2db1bd56420ba
1 Input
1 Output
-
100995230fd30b692b4ca5fca2053b0ac7fdb168c97bb8d96ac2db1bd56420ba:0
- value
- 1579094
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f930f182af502bd97d395808d3bb95cd9fca6d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JTxEUaSLKyxBHoNUbdnEiUqkjZ8j3smmK